如何设置图形大小

4,785次观看(最近30天)
索尼胡
索尼胡 2013年2月28日
如何将我的图形大小设置为(w:h = 550:400)现在我的图形大小为560:420(自动)
[day_number,daily_rain] = dailyrain(Raindata,2010,1);
andemande =情节(day_number,daily_rain,'-好的');
set(andemande,'行宽',1);
day_numbermax = max(day_number);
day_numbermin = min(day_number);
DateTick('X',,,,'dd-mmm',,,,'keepticks'
网格;
ylabel('Akumulasi Curah Hujan(MM)'
Xlabel('Hari'
xlim([Day_numbermin day_numbermax])
1条评论
索尼胡
索尼胡 2013年2月28日
要设置的代码..

登录发表评论。

接受的答案

Azzi Abdelmalek
Azzi Abdelmalek 2013年2月28日
编辑:Mathworks支金宝app持团队 2021年3月16日
在当前图(GCF)上设置“位置”属性。将位置指定为“ [x0 y0宽度高度]”形式的向量,其中“ x0”和“ y0”定义了从屏幕左下角到图的左下角的距离。默认情况下,位置为像素。
x0 = 10;
y0 = 10;
宽度= 550;
高度= 400
设置(GCF,'位置',[X0,Y0,宽度,高度])
您可以指定其他单元(英寸,厘米,归一化,点或字符)。例如:
设置(GCF,'单位',,,,“点”,,,,'位置',[X0,Y0,宽度,高度])
您还可以将句柄保存到图形上,并使用点表示法设置位置属性:
f =图;
f.position = [10 10 550 400];
7条评论
OséiasFarias
OséiasFarias 2021年7月4日
谢谢!

登录发表评论。

更多答案(1)

Amirhossein sadeghi势力
Amirhossein sadeghi势力 2021年7月22日
编辑:Amirhossein sadeghi势力 2021年7月22日
在Matlab的文档中提到了调整大小的大小。
Doc数字
向下滚动到 更改数字大小 部分。
如果您没有为自己的数字分配名称,请使用 GCF (GCF中的CF代表当前图)。
无花果= GCF;
图。位置(3:4)= [550,400];
并将这两条线放在您感兴趣的情节之前。
如果您的目的只是改变您的数字的宽度和高度,那么您的问题听起来像这样,那么您就不需要更改第一个和第二个条目 位置 。前两个条目是关于屏幕中图形窗口的位置,您可以拖放该窗口,并且对图形的大小没有影响(因此对将您放入纸张/书中的内容没有影响 ^_ ^ ^)。

社区寻宝

在Matlab Central中找到宝藏,发现社区如何为您提供帮助!

开始狩猎!